How to Prepare for Interviews

Interviews are a sort of discussion between the interviewer and interviewee. Interviews are very significant for all those who hunt for a good job. Through interviews, interviewers assess the analytical abilities of the candidates, their skills and their overall personality. Job seekers come across various interviews from time to time.
Interviews are basically meant to get an insight into the thinking process of the candidate. In interviews, abilities of the candidate to handle difficult situations, his expertise and also the assessment of whether he would be able to do justice with his job or not is done.
Interviews are generally taken by some high authority of the organization. They are interested in those smart candidates who can bring more profit to their organization and create its positive image in the market. While taking interviews, interviewers check whether the candidate can identify the problem, formulate the problem and then make use of his analytical ability to solve it.
Those who take interviews wish to see whether you can develop structure framework for solution to any problem which has been correctly identified and well-formulated. While taking interviews, the candidate should keep in mind that during the process their thinking process is being analyzed and hence they should not give instant answers and think before they speak.
While taking interviews, candidates should take proper care of attire. They should be dressed in a decent manner and should not put on clothes which are uncomfortable to them. Candidates should always try to dispose his good manners while taking interviews like he should wish all the panel members and to the ladies first. They should also deny taking snacks of they are offered by the panel members. They should be polite and well spoken to all.
Long and short of this lies in the fact, that the candidate should present his best in the interviews.
